About the role

Leadership scope

A Managing Director sets direction and turns it into execution. Companies bring one in to lead a business unit, stabilize operations, or guide a transition when the board needs a clear hand on the wheel. In German-speaking contexts, searchers may also look for a Geschäftsführer or general manager, depending on the company setup.

  • Define priorities and decision paths
  • Lead leadership teams and key stakeholders
  • Align strategy with budgets, KPIs, and delivery
  • Keep sales, operations, and finance moving together

Typical assignments

Freelance Managing Directors are often used for time-bound projects where speed and clarity matter. That includes interim leadership during a vacancy, post-merger integration, turnaround support, market entry in Germany, or preparing a company for scaling or a sale. In Nuremberg, this can be especially relevant for industrial firms, B2B service providers, and family-owned businesses that need senior support without a long hiring process.

Core strengths

This role is not only about authority. It requires judgment, calm under pressure, and the ability to turn broad business goals into daily action. Strong candidates understand P&L responsibility, change management, negotiation, and people leadership. They can read a company quickly, ask the right questions, and make trade-offs without losing the bigger picture.

Tools and context

Managing Directors work with board decks, budgets, forecasts, KPI dashboards, CRM and ERP data, and regular review cycles. They often step into companies where processes are in flux, ownership expectations are high, or different departments are pulling in different directions. For freelance work, the best fit is someone who can operate remotely for steering and planning, then come on-site in Nuremberg when presence, trust, or crisis handling is needed.

What good looks like

The best freelance Managing Directors are decisive without being rigid. They build trust fast, communicate clearly, and stay close to numbers and execution. They also adapt their style to the company: hands-on in an SME, structured in a corporate environment, and diplomatic when working with owners, works councils, or long-standing teams.

A freelance Managing Director takes over senior leadership tasks that need immediate clarity. That can include business direction, team alignment, budget ownership, crisis handling, and communication with owners or the board. The exact scope should be defined early, especially if the role is meant to cover a vacancy or a change project.

An interim Managing Director makes sense when the company needs leadership now, but not necessarily a permanent hire. This is common during a vacancy, restructuring, integration after an acquisition, or when a founder wants to step back in an orderly way. It is also useful when the company wants an external view before making a long-term decision.

Look for proven P&L responsibility, people leadership, and the ability to make decisions under pressure. A strong candidate understands sales, operations, finance, and stakeholder management, not just one functional area. For many assignments, change management and negotiation skills matter as much as industry knowledge.

The title Managing Director is often used broadly for top operational leadership, but the exact meaning depends on the company and country. In Germany, Geschäftsführer is a common legal and business title for similar responsibility, while general manager is sometimes used for the same level in international firms. What matters most is the actual scope, authority, and accountability in the role.

Freelance Managing Directors are a good fit for restructuring, growth preparation, market entry, post-merger integration, or stabilizing a unit after a leadership change. They are also useful when a company needs a bridge solution before a permanent hire is made. The best projects have a clear objective and a defined handover point.

A Managing Director can often work partly remote for planning, reporting, and leadership alignment. On-site presence is usually important when they need to build trust, lead major change, or work closely with plant, sales, or operations teams. For companies in Nuremberg, a mixed setup is often the most practical choice.

Judge the candidate by the problems they have solved, not by the title alone. Ask for examples of turnaround work, team leadership, and how they handled difficult decisions with owners or senior stakeholders. A good Managing Director explains their approach clearly, sets priorities fast, and shows how they create results through others.

A freelance Managing Director should confirm decision rights, reporting lines, goals, and who the key stakeholders are. It is also important to agree on the expected level of presence in Nuremberg, the handover plan, and how success will be measured. Clear alignment at the start avoids confusion later.
